BOXED IN, IN SUBURBIA
In a Southern suburb of Dortmund, Germany, a 1940s-era single-family house has undergone a transformation. Originally topped by a pitched roof like that of its neighbors, the house now has an added apartment, a new shape, and the appearance of a wood block. The award-winning house has inserted a dialog of design perhaps novel to the traditional neighborhood. Next week we'll see how the house fits in.

DALI'S PRIVATE RETREAT
Throughout his life, Spanish artist Salvador Dalí played the role of provocateur. But behind his extravagance was a more subtle, private person. His formative years centered on the creation — with his wife Gala Diakonova — of a house in the remote Port of Lligat on the Mediterranean coast. Next week author Rachel Grossman will explain why the house reflects the true Dalí. (Photo by Rachel Grossman, authorized by the Gala-Dalí Foundation.)
